As a leader in the tourism or hospitality sector, you understand that seamless accessibility and efficient regulatory frameworks are pivotal to unlocking new markets and driving sustainable growth. India’s recent strides in expanding air connectivity alongside the modernization of its e-visa system aren’t just incremental changes—they represent a strategic inflection point for your business, your destination, and the broader industry ecosystem. This transformation is creating unprecedented opportunities for competitive differentiation, enhanced profitability, and premiumisation.
India’s tourism economy is no longer confined to its major metropolitan hubs. By connecting tier-2 and tier-3 cities directly to international airports, the country is broadening its tourism geography, inviting you to rethink and expand your business strategy. Additionally, the streamlined e-visa facilitates ease of entry for global travelers, mitigating friction that once limited inbound flow. If you aspire to capitalize on emerging segments such as wellness, spiritual tourism, or premium experiential travel, these developments amplify your reach, revenue potential, and brand relevance.
India’s civil aviation authorities and tourism policymakers have collaboratively executed a two-pronged approach. Firstly, new international flight routes are targeting previously overlooked cities, improving access to hidden cultural and ecological gems. This decentralized air connectivity aligns with scalable infrastructure investment plans, enabling airport authorities and aviation partners to gear up for diversified passenger demand.
Secondly, the e-visa system has been overhauled to reduce procedural delays and eliminate barriers for visitors, encouraging longer stays and repeat visits. Travel technology platforms are leveraging this to enhance booking conversion with integrated, hassle-free visa facilitation, ensuring a frictionless traveler journey from intention to arrival.

Despite promising infrastructure and policy changes, challenges remain. Infrastructure development must keep pace with increasing passenger volumes without compromising quality or sustainability. Over-tourism in newly accessible locations risks degrading local culture and environments if not managed responsibly. Additionally, technology adoption gaps and inconsistent policy enforcement could hinder full realization of connectivity benefits.
Balancing rapid growth with these risks demands decisive leadership and evidence-based strategy, with continuous monitoring of traveler trends, infrastructure quality, and community impact.
